The Impact of Electronics on the Environment:

Electronic devices have become an integral part of modern life, but their production and disposal contribute significantly to environmental degradation. The extraction of raw materials, manufacturing processes, and the accumulation of electronic waste (e-waste) pose serious threats to ecosystems. The Green Revolution aims to address these issues by promoting sustainable practices throughout the life cycle of electronic products.

Sustainable Electronics Practices:

Material Sourcing:

The journey towards sustainability begins with responsible material sourcing. Manufacturers are increasingly turning to recycled and responsibly mined materials to reduce the environmental impact of electronic devices. This not only minimizes the depletion of natural resources but also curtails the harmful effects of mining on ecosystems.

Energy Efficiency:

One of the cornerstones of sustainable electronics is energy efficiency. Tech companies are now prioritizing the development of energy-efficient devices, which not only lowers operational costs but also reduces carbon emissions. From low-power processors to energy-saving display technologies, these innovations are helping to create electronics that are both eco-friendly and economical.

Modular Design:

Embracing a modular design philosophy is another key aspect of sustainable electronics. Modular devices are built with components that can be easily replaced or upgraded, extending the lifespan of the product. This not only reduces electronic waste but also allows users to keep their devices up-to-date without the need for complete replacements.

Eco-Friendly Packaging:

Sustainable practices extend beyond the device itself to its packaging. Manufacturers are adopting eco-friendly packaging materials, such as recycled cardboard and biodegradable plastics, to minimize waste and reduce the environmental impact of product packaging.

Eco-Friendly Tech Solutions:

Solar-Powered Gadgets:

Harnessing the power of the sun, solar-powered gadgets are becoming increasingly popular. From solar chargers for smartphones to solar-powered backpacks with built-in charging ports, these innovations allow users to stay connected while reducing reliance on traditional power sources.

Biodegradable Electronics:

The development of biodegradable electronics is a groundbreaking step towards a sustainable future. Researchers are exploring materials that break down naturally over time, reducing the environmental impact of electronic waste. From circuit boards to casings, these biodegradable components offer a greener alternative to traditional electronics.

E-Waste Recycling Initiatives:

Tackling the growing issue of e-waste, many tech companies are implementing e-waste recycling initiatives. These programs encourage users to return their old devices for proper disposal and recycling, preventing hazardous materials from entering landfills and promoting the reuse of valuable resources.

Energy Harvesting Technologies:

Energy harvesting technologies are gaining traction as a means to power electronic devices sustainably. From kinetic energy harvesting in wearables to ambient light harvesting in sensors, these technologies generate power from the environment, reducing the need for traditional batteries and minimizing electronic waste.
